HySpex is proud to unveil a new milestone in airborne hyperspectral imaging: a fully integrated Mjolnir V-1240 system that weighs in at under 2 kg. This lightweight solution combines the power and precision HySpex is known for with a form factor optimized for small UAVs—ushering in a new era of flexible, high-performance airborne applications.
A tradition of excellence — Now even lighter
HySpex has long been recognized for delivering industry-leading hyperspectral imaging systems that are known for exceptional quality, robustness, and reliability. However, these full-featured solutions have typically come with a tradeoff: weight. Our rugged Mjolnir systems, known for their shoebox-sized modularity, multiple IOs, and field adaptability, generally start at 4 kg per camera — reaching over 6 kg in combined VNIR and SWIR configurations.
But times are changing.
In recent years, we've quietly been developing and shipping lightweight OEM versions of our UAV systems. The result? A compact configuration of the Mjolnir V-1240 that includes the hyperspectral camera, a powerful onboard computer, and a Trimble Applanix navigation unit — all bundled into a solution weighing less than 2 kg. We are also offering a SWIR option (950 - 2500nm) with a Mjolnir S-620 system that weighs in at under 2.5 kg.

Real-time processing, real-world readiness
Both systems are fully compatible with HySpex’s upcoming real-time processing software. This allows onboard hyperspectral data analysis directly on small UAV platforms, enabling smarter, faster decision-making in the field.
